Subject: Re: [PATCH net] ibmveth: Fix max MTU limit
Date: Thu, 18 Jun 2020 15:51:48 -0500	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<ef46e726-5be4-de64-a34c-8a98823a920a@linux.ibm.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20200618085722.110f3702@kicinski-fedora-PC1C0HJN>


On 6/18/20 10:57 AM, Jakub Kicinski wrote:
> On Thu, 18 Jun 2020 10:43:46 -0500 Thomas Falcon wrote:
>> The max MTU limit defined for ibmveth is not accounting for
>> virtual ethernet buffer overhead, which is twenty-two additional
>> bytes set aside for the ethernet header and eight additional bytes
>> of an opaque handle reserved for use by the hypervisor. Update the
>> max MTU to reflect this overhead.
